Assessing Your Roof’s Condition
First, inspect your roof carefully. Next, check shingles, flashing, and gutters. Then, review attic rafters for stains. Consequently, you uncover hidden problems early.
- Inspect shingles for cracks and curling edges.
- Examine flashing around chimneys and vents.
- Look inside the attic for light and stains.
- Photograph visible problems to help contractors.

Choosing the Right Materials
Material choice shapes durability. Asphalt shingles are affordable. Meanwhile, metal offers efficiency and longevity. Tiles resist heat, but they require strong structures. Therefore, confirm load limits first.
- Compare durability, warranties, and maintenance requirements.
- Confirm delivery schedules to avoid delays.
- Order slightly extra for waste and repairs.

Securing Necessary Permits
Building codes vary. Therefore, confirm requirements with local authorities. Additionally, clarify whether contractors handle permits. Because details matter, document agreements carefully.
After applying, expect a waiting period. Sometimes, revisions are requested. Consequently, include extra time in your roof prep timeline. Moreover, never begin without proper authorization.
Setting a Realistic Budget
A clear budget reduces stress. Start with material and labor estimates. Then, add fees and potential repairs. Therefore, accuracy is essential.
Additionally, allocate 10–15% for contingencies. Unexpected issues happen. Consequently, you remain prepared. Align payment milestones with project phases for accountability.
Scheduling the Prep Work
Weather affects progress. Therefore, choose mild days. Next, divide tasks into phases: tear-off, repair, underlayment, flashing, shingles, and cleanup.
- Check weather forecasts before scheduling.
- Build buffer days for delivery or delays.
- Keep a shared calendar for updates.

Preparing Your Home for the Project
Preparation matters. Remove cars and outdoor items. Cover indoor furniture with cloths. Additionally, trim trees near the roof. Therefore, you reduce risks.
Notify neighbors about noise. Arrange care for pets. Consequently, disruptions stay minimal. Preparation helps workers remain efficient and safe.

FAQs
How long does a typical roof prep timeline take?
It depends on roof size, material availability, and weather. Usually, it ranges from one week to three weeks.
Can I stay home during roof preparation?
Yes, but expect noise and dust. Therefore, plan accordingly. Pets may require temporary relocation for safety.
Do I need permits for all roofing projects?
Most projects require permits. Therefore, check local codes early. Additionally, clarify responsibilities with your contractor in writing.
What materials last the longest?
Metal and tile roofs offer superior longevity. However, material choice should align with climate, budget, and structural strength.
